Tiivistelmä

In this chapter, we set forward a social network perspective on professional learning and development. The chapter stresses that how individuals learn and develop in and around the workplace is significantly affected by the way they are tied into a larger web of social connections. We reflect on the added value of a social network perspective to workplace learning research. Building on exemplary findings of recent studies, it shows that the pattern and quality of social relationships among professionals may significantly enhance our understanding of the ways in which interaction takes place and contributes to learning and development. We discuss how a social network approach allows to capture professional interactions in a more straightforward, visual and fine-grained way; and how it can simultaneously capture professional interactions at different levels of analysis (e.g., individuals, teams, units, organizations). We conclude by looking forward and setting up several avenues for future research.
